SINGAPORE — The maid who was with a four-year-old girl who was killed in a car accident in January had jaywalked with her in River Valley, despite being told not to. A coroner's inquiry into the death of Zara Mei Orlic was held on June 26, after she had died on Jan 23 when a car hit her at Institution Hill at River Valley. During the inquiry, it was revealed that Zara had dashed across the road when the accident happened. Zara had suddenly appeared between two stationary vehicles parked along Institution Hill, which is a two-lane road, when a car driving from the opposite direction hit her. Traffic Police station inspector (SI) Muhammad Firdaus Suleiman was called as a witness. He said the maid, who was holding the hand of Zara's two-year-old sister, was three steps behind Zara and yelled for the car to stop when the collision occurred. When assisting officer Jeanice Lim asked how long it took for Zara to be visible in the in-car camera footage to when she was hit, SI Firdaus replied that it was one second. Read more
